Contents
Introduction : political meanings : practices and theories, feminisms and postmodernisms -- The means of reproduction : the female performance art tradition, form, humour and ideology -- The size of the apparatus : drag, masquerade, mimicry, performativity and Bertolt Brecht -- Undecidable doublings : the performativity of performance in Rose English's The double wedding -- The active consumer : Bobby Baker's How to shop -- Becoming part of the show, the I of the beholder : Annie sprinkle's Post post porn modernist -- Conclusion: Closing words, opening questions : ethical activism, the politics of undecidability and Rose English's Tantamount Esperance.
